Elisabeth Perrault

Elisabeth Perrault (born in 1996 in Joliette) lives and works in Montreal. She obtained her bachelor’s degree from Concordia University in 2020 and is currently pursuing her master’s degree there. Elisabeth Perrault has presented three solo exhibitions at Galerie Pangée: Ces petites morts domestiques in 2021, Danser avec nos fantômes in 2023, and Nature pointue in 2025. In 2024, she presented Les mascarades, a solo exhibition at Maison de la culture Maisonneuve, as well as a duo exhibition at Carvalho Park (New York). She is currently working on a solo exhibition scheduled for 2025 at CIRCA artist-run center. Notably, she collaborated with artist Patrick Watson on the music video for his song Better in the Shade in 2022. Perrault’s work is also featured in the research of art historian Dr. Julia Skelly for her upcoming book Threads: Cloth in Contemporary Queer, Feminist and Anti-racist Art (Bloomsbury Academic, 2025). Her work was recently acquired by the Musée d’art contemporain de Baie-Saint-Paul following her participation in the 2024 symposium. Elisabeth is represented by Pangée.
